About the role
As a Senior Data Modeler at this company, you will play a crucial role in designing and shaping enterprise data architecture. Your responsibilities will include: - Designing, developing, and maintaining conceptual, logical, and physical data models - Leading complex data modeling initiatives across business and technology teams - Collaborating with stakeholders across IT, finance, legal, and business units - Ensuring alignment between enterprise data architecture and business needs - Balancing technical standards with evolving business requirements - Supporting and guiding decision-making on data structures and architecture - Ensuring compliance with data governance, security, and regulatory requirements - Providing documentation and contributing to audit and compliance activities - Managing expectations of senior stakeholders and resolving conflicting priorities - Identifying opportunities for optimization and innovation in data architecture - Mentoring team members and providing technical leadership - Collaborating with vendors and external partners when required Qualifications required for this role: - Strong experience in data modeling and data architecture - Deep understanding of enterprise data systems and technology ecosystems - Knowledge of data governance, compliance, and documentation standards - Ability to manage complex stakeholder environments and competing priorities - Strong problem-solving skills with the ability to address complex challenges - Experience leading or contributing to large-scale data initiatives - Ability to work independently with minimal supervision - Strong communication and stakeholder management skills This company offers you the opportunity to work on large-scale, enterprise data initiatives, exposure to global stakeholders and cross-functional teams, a hybrid working environment, and career growth in a data-driven, innovation-focused organization.
